Episode Thirteen

A Male-Focused Solution for the Male Problem of Violence Against Women

"Violence against women is the biggest human rights violation in the world. We’re talking about 50% of the global community, and seven in 10 women will experience violence in their life. These are serious issues."

Henry McDonald.jpg

In this episode, Judithe is joined by Ambassador Henry MacDonald of Suriname to discuss violence against women, one of the most devastating issues affecting gender equality. Ambassador MacDonald discusses some of his work with the United Nations and the government of Iceland to increase male awareness as both the source of this endemic problem as well as the solution to it.
